In the Buddhist tradition, the five hindrances (Sinhala: පඤ්ච නීවරණ pañca nīvaraṇa; Pali: pañca nīvaraṇāni) are identified as mental factors that hinder progress in meditation and in our daily lives. In the Theravada tradition, these factors are identified specifically as obstacles to the jhānas (stages of concentration) within meditation practice. Within the Mahayana tradition, the five hindrances are identified as obstacles to samatha (tranquility) meditation. Contemporary Insight … WebThe Buddha addressed those gathered: “Friends, there are these five hindrances: Sensual desire is a hindrance. Ill will is a hindrance. Laziness, indifference, and drowsiness is a hindrance. Restlessness and anxiety is a hindrance. Doubt, uncertainty, skepticism (of the Dhamma) is a hindrance. “These are the five hindrances (To be mindful of).
